Chef Ben Robinson was born in the United Kingdom and developed an early interest in culinary arts. He completed a diploma in Culinary Arts at The Culinary Institute of America. Following his formal training, he gained experience in various high-end kitchens, including the Fat Duck, a three-Michelin-star restaurant in Bray, Berkshire, UK. His career soon transitioned into private yachting, where he honed his skills in diverse culinary environments, catering to a range of discerning clients.
His career significantly progressed with his appearances on the Bravo reality television series “Below Deck” and “Below Deck Mediterranean.” He made his debut on “Below Deck” in its first season, which premiered in July 2013. He continued as the resident chef for “Below Deck” Seasons 1, 2, and 4. During “Below Deck” Season 3, he was called in to serve as chef for the final three episodes. He then extended his involvement in the franchise by joining “Below Deck Mediterranean” for Season 1 and later returned for Season 4. These roles showcased his ability to manage intense pressure while consistently delivering high-quality cuisine in challenging conditions.
Currently, Chef Robinson resides in Florida, where he operates a private catering company and continues to create cooking content, including tutorials filmed from his home kitchen. He has engaged in various partnerships and continues to make appearances within the “Below Deck” franchise, most notably his anticipated return as chef for “Below Deck Down Under” Season 4.
